Analysis
The most recent figure for financial derivatives (other than reserves) and employee stock in Mozambique is 4.83 million, measured in 2024.
Compared with earlier readings it is up 149.1% on the previous year.
Over the whole period, financial derivatives (other than reserves) and employee stock in Mozambique peaked at 16.00 million in 2007 and was at its lowest, -9.83 million, in 2023.
Mozambique ranks 36th of 164 countries on this measure, in the top quarter.
The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.

About this data
The World and Country Group Aggregates (historically called BOPSY) is an annual publication, released each November, of major balance of payments and international investment position components for countries, country groups, and the world.
